News Brown, Lavin and Klein Part of All-Star Sisters Rosensweig Benefit Tony Award winners Blair Brown and Linda Lavin will join original cast member Robert Klein for an all-star 10th anniversary benefit reading of The Sisters Rosensweig Jan. 26.

The one-night-only event will benefit the Breast Cancer Research Foundation and will also feature the talents of Amy Irving, Michelle Williams and John Michael Higgins. Daniel Sullivan, who directed the original production of Wendy Wasserstein’s play, will helm the reading at the Virginia Theatre. Wendy Wasserstein's play about three American Jewish sisters who undergo an identity crisis when they gather in London after their mother dies played Broadway’s Ethel Barrymore Theatre March 1993-July 1994. The original Broadway cast featured Jane Alexander, Madeline Kahn, Robert Klein, Christine Estabrook, John Vickery, John Cunningham, Julie Dretzin and Patrick Fitzgerald. The late Madeline Kahn won a Tony Award for her performance as Gorgeous Teitelbaum.
